Native Youth Olympic Games Alaska has quite a bit of history, and the NYO Games brings Anchorage annual cultural fun! Starting in 1972, the NYO Games included various sporting events based on Alaskan Natives of past generations. It was a way to test survival skills, hunting skills, endurance and more.
